Roger wrote:

Actually all I need is to fix the orange/yellow plastic window over
the display. Some where in the past (before I purchased the Deb) I'd
guess some one used the wrong stuff to try and clean the window.
Combined with age that has rendered the plastic window almost opaque.
I wonder if the stuff they use to fix scratched plastic glasses would
work on that? Trying would certainly be cheaper than purchasing
another radio or even front panel. The KY197s are going for as much
on E-bay (yellow tagged) as a new KY97.


If the plastic window is all that is wrong with it, you're a lucky man.
Most old KY-97s have a problem with the LCD display going wacky (particularly
when the unit is cold). You have to push on the face of the radio to make it
read correctly. This is such a common problem that I'd shy away from a used
KY-97, unless I could verify that it was still fairly young.

If it's just the window plastic, you could just undo the two screws on each
side of the radio that hold the faceplate on. The plastic piece will fall
right out. It shouldn't be too hard to find something that'll work in there
(or maybe leave it out altogether).

Since my display went crazy, I decided to go with an ICOM IC-A200 as a
slide-in replacement. Pacific Coast Avionics was selling them for $800. Not
bad when you consider the price of a new KY-97A.
